Transaction aaf46851103efc064aa2151b0d0cbccce9987606413840967921578561b5aa88
1 Input
1 Output
-
aaf46851103efc064aa2151b0d0cbccce9987606413840967921578561b5aa88:0
- value
- 1172868
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d429810b65724c5e175a60f2ff27ae400cb423a
- address
- bc1q34pfsy9k2ujvtct45c8jlun6usqvks36fuhzzx